WebThe shipowner Serco NorthLink Ferries (founded in 2002, headquartered in Stromness, Orkney Island) is a Scottish passenger shipping company operating services between Shetland Islands and mainland Scotland. NorthLink Ferries current cruiseferry fleet includes the 2002-built ships Hamnavoe, Hjaltland and Hrossey. WebNorthLink's fleet, MV Hjaltland, MV Hrossey and MV Hamnavoe, was purpose built for the service and offer cruise-liner standards in safety and comfort. WebMS. Helliar. Helliar is a ferry owned by Caledonian Maritime Assets and operated by NorthLink Ferries. Built by Astilleros de Huelva in Spain in 1997 as Lehola for the Estonian Shipping Company she has served a number of owners and operators as RR Triumph and Triumph before her sale to Clipper Group and being renamed Clipper Racer.
